click and drag each structure into a category to determine whether it is associated with the axon terminal or the motor end plate. labels drop zones reset all acetylcholine receptors motor end plate (1/2) axon terminal (2/2) sarcoplasm myelin voltage - gated ca²⁺ channels sarcolemma synaptic vesicles filled with acetylcholine

Explanation:

Brief Explanations

Acetylcholine receptors are located on the motor - end plate to bind with acetylcholine. Sarcoplasm is the cytoplasm of muscle cells and is part of the motor - end plate region. Sarcolemma is the plasma membrane of muscle cells associated with the motor - end plate. Myelin is a fatty sheath around axons and not directly related to the motor - end plate or axon terminal in this context. Voltage - gated Ca²⁺ channels are in the axon terminal and allow calcium influx for neurotransmitter release. Synaptic vesicles filled with acetylcholine are in the axon terminal for exocytosis.

Answer:

Motor End Plate: Acetylcholine receptors, Sarcoplasm, Sarcolemma
Axon Terminal: Voltage - gated Ca²⁺ channels, Synaptic vesicles filled with acetylcholine
Myelin: Neither (not directly associated with either in this context)
